MLB All-Star Game: Dodger Stadium concession workers won't strike, union announces

Unionized Dodger Stadium concession workers have agreed not to strike for the upcoming MLB All-Star Game and related events, the union announced Friday.

Mike Brito, Dodgers scout who found Fernando Valenzuela, dies at 87

Mike Brito, the Dodgers scout who is credited with discovering talents like Fernando Valenzuela, Julio Urías and Yasiel Puig, has died.

Dodgers officially retire Gil Hodges' number

Hodges' No. 14 is the first to be retired since the Dodgers retired Don Sutton's No. 20 in 1998.

Dodgers' Geremias Valencia among 3 minor leaguers suspended for 60 games

Los Angeles Dodgers outfielder Geremias Valencia was among three players suspended for 60 games each Friday following positive tests under baseball’s minor league drug program.

Clayton Kershaw sets Dodgers' franchise strikeout record

Clayton Kershaw struck out Spencer Torkelson in the top of the fourth inning Saturday night, setting the Dodgers' franchise strikeout record with 2,697.
